Please discuss with the hiring manager or recruiter for more details.Job Summary LPNResponsible for providing direct patient care, ongoing education, and reinforcement of care plans, and providing general support in an ambulatory setting under the direction or supervision of the patient's physician or LIP/RN designee in accordance with policy, procedure, and competency to promote patient health and wellness. This position requires providing services to all age populations in a manner that demonstrates an understanding of the functional/developmental age of the individuals served.Job Summary MAMedical Assistants provide clinical support, assist with administrative tasks, and provide general support in an ambulatory setting under the direction or supervision of the patient's physician or LIP/RN designee in accordance with policy, procedure, and competency to promote patient health and wellness. Duties may include patient care, vital signs, assisting licensed health care professionals, performing various laboratory tests, quality control indicators, and clinical intake. This position requires providing service to all age populations in a manner that demonstrates an understanding of the functional/developmental age of the individual served.**Licensed Practical Nurse - Ambulatory**+ Assist the registered nurse and/or provider through data collection concerning the physical, psychological, social, and cultural dimensions of patients according to practice standards and institutional policy/procedure.+ Organizes and prioritizes nursing care activities considering the needs of the patients and the interdisciplinary team.+ Implements age-appropriate interventions based on individual patient's needs as directed by the registered nurse/provider.+ Assist in evaluating the effectiveness of care given in progressing patients toward desired outcomes.+ Provide ongoing education and reinforcement of care plans developed by the Provider/RN based on identified health and education needs and the condition and age of the patient.+ Provides a safe environment and safe delivery of care.+ Assumes responsibility for professional development of self and contributes to and assists with the professional development of others.+ Demonstrates teamwork in the delivery of patient care.+ In addition to other job responsibilities, other duties may be assigned.**Medical Assistant - Ambulatory**+ Assists in assuring effective and efficient clinic operations while maintaining consistent and accurate communication with team members, referring providers, and patients.+ Assists with data collection for physical, psychological, social, and cultural dimensions of patients according to professional practice standards and institutional policy/procedure.+ Completes standardized rooming and performs clinical intake, data collection, and documentation.+ As directed and in accordance with documented competencies, provides clinical support to licensed healthcare professionals during examinations and procedures. Clinical support services include but are not limited to preparing laboratory specimens, performing testing (i.e. point of care testing, CLIA waived testing ECG/EKG, spirometry, venipuncture/phlebotomy, specimen collection, etc.), appropriate cleaning and sterilization of instruments/equipment and rooms, disposing of contaminated supplies, performing wound care, administering medications.+ Organizes and prioritizes daily work assignments to support patient needs, the interdisciplinary team, and operational efficiency.+ Implements age-appropriate interventions based on individual patient needs as directed by the Health Care Provider (HCP).+ Reinforces patient/family teaching plan based on identified health education needs and the condition and age of the patient through approved educational materials or written instructions.+ Provides for a safe environment and safe delivery of care.+ Maintains supplies and equipment.+ Document and capture charges for clinical support services rendered within the patient visit.+ Performs administrative support responsibilities. As directed and in accordance with documented competencies, provides administrative support to licensed healthcare professionals. Administrative support services include but are not limited to draft letters and/or assist with completion of forms, facilitate scheduling, pend medication refills, assist with coverage of in basket messaging, assist with clinic/chart prep.+ Demonstrates teamwork in the delivery of patient care. Recognizes the importance of time sensitive issues.+ Assumes responsibility for professional development of self and others according to departmental policy.+ In addition to the above job responsibilities, other duties may be assigned.**M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S FOR LICENSED PRACTICAL NURSE:**Education:+ Graduated from an accredited Licensed Practical Nurse ProgramExperience:+ None RequiredLicensure:+ Licensed to practice as a Practical Nurse (LPN) in the Commonwealth of Virginia prior to onboarding.+ American Heart Association (AHA) Healthcare Provider BLS certification requiredPhysical Demands:Job requires standing for prolonged periods, frequently traveling, and bending/stooping. Proficient communicative, auditory, and visual skills;attention to detail and ability to write legibly; ability to lift/push/pull 20-50lbs. May be exposed to chemicals, blood/body fluids, and infectious diseases**M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S FOR MEDICAL ASSISTANTS:**Education:+ High School Diploma or equivalent required.Experience:+ None requiredLicensure:+ American Heart Association (AHA) Health Care Provider BLS certification required.+ Currently enrolled or have completion of a Medical Assistant Program accredited by the Commission on Accreditation of Allied Health Education (CAAHEP) or Accrediting Bureau of Health Education Schools (ABHES) **and/or** hold a current Medical Assistant Certification through a recognized national professional association such as the AAMA (American Association of Medical Assistants), the AMT (American Medical Technologists), NAHP (The National Association of Healthcare Professions), the ARMA (American Registry of Medical Assistants), or the NHA (National Healthcare Association).+ Medical Assistant Certification must be obtained within 6 months from the date of hire.PHYSICAL DEMANDSThe job requires standing for prolonged periods and frequently bending/stooping/traveling.
